Hi! I’m Montana Rae

I'm a commercial real estate broker, designer, project manager, property owner, and business founder with over fifteen years of experience in sales and digital marketing. My practice brings a focused, service-first approach built on communication, research, and an intimate knowledge of the Denver market.

Backed by the expertise of boutique Denver firm Henry Group Real Estate, I provide full-spectrum service to help my clients achieve their goals, from brokerage to development to customizable property management.

I work in various asset classes, including mixed-use development, retail, healthcare, office, industrial, multifamily, and land. My clients are buyers, sellers, investors, landlords, and tenants. 

The broad strokes of my practice allow me to serve my clients throughout their lives, as no two people or assets are the same. My goal has always been to work with people consistently through the years. As their needs evolve, our relationship does, too.

Originally from Aspen, Colorado, I moved to the Front Range in the early 2000s. I earned a degree in Interior Design from the Art Institute of Colorado, focusing on restaurant design, marketing, and business management.

I worked in the commercial design industry and cut my teeth behind the bar at a busy Denver club. Over the years, I developed a deep appreciation for fine wine. I spent more than a decade in sales and marketing. I experienced nearly every channel of the wine industry, from distribution to production and education, eventually becoming a Certified Sommelier and starting my own small wine company, The Wine Ship.

When I launched my career in commercial real estate, I found a confluence of the skills I've acquired in design, construction, marketing, sales, planning, and, above all, service.

Having lived in Denver for nearly 20 years, I've watched this city evolve. The longer I'm here, the more inspired I am to contribute to the greatness of the Mile High City.

The unique skill set and perspective I bring to the business, paired with my intimate understanding of the Denver market, has been the most rewarding thing I could imagine.
